遇到「Windows 无法连接到打印机服务器」或系统提示「本地打印后台处理程序服务没有运行」,多是 Print Spooler 服务停止、C:\Windows\System32\spool\PRINTERS 目录有残留卡件,或 0x0000011b 注册表缺少配置项所致,共享打印机本身大多没坏,不必急着换机或重装系统。
以下 5 步在 Windows 10/11 实测可用——启动 Spooler 并设自动、清除 PRINTERS 卡件、修复 0x0000011b 注册表、核对共享端设置与防火墙、开启网络发现与 SMB 协议,按顺序排查、修好即停即可。
适用系统:Windows 10/11;最后更新:2026-06-22。
打印机共享连不上是什么情况
在「设备和打印机」中添加网络/共享打印机时,系统弹出"Windows 无法连接到打印机""本地打印后台处理程序服务没有运行",或显示错误码 0x0000011b、0x00000bc4——这说明打印机调度服务(Print Spooler)或共享通道出现了问题,并不意味着打印机硬件损坏。
先对照错误码与现象判断方向,再按对应方法处理,能省去大量反复重装驱动的时间。
方法一 启动并固化 Print Spooler 服务
Print Spooler 是所有打印任务的调度核心,服务停止后任何共享打印机都会连不上。启动服务并将其设为「自动」是最快的第一步,操作不超过一分钟。
操作步骤
- 按
Win+R,输入services.msc,回车,打开服务管理器 - 在列表中找到 Print Spooler,右键→启动(若已运行则选右键→重新启动)
- 再次右键→属性,将「启动类型」改为「自动」,点确定
- 也可在命令提示符(管理员)运行
net start spooler启动服务,再运行sc config spooler start=auto固化为自动启动 - 重新在「设备和打印机」中添加共享打印机,验证是否连接成功
若 Spooler 启动后立刻又停止,通常是 PRINTERS 目录有残留卡件在触发服务崩溃,继续执行方法二。
方法二 清除 PRINTERS 目录卡死任务
C:\Windows\System32\spool\PRINTERS 下的残留文件会在 Print Spooler 启动时立刻触发崩溃或阻塞新连接,清空该目录内的文件可解除阻塞。
操作步骤
- 按
Win+R输入services.msc,找到 Print Spooler,右键→停止 - 打开文件资源管理器,进入
C:\Windows\System32\spool\PRINTERS - 按
Ctrl+A选中目录内所有文件,按 Delete 删除;文件夹本身保留,不要删除 - 回到服务管理器,右键 Print Spooler→启动
- 重新添加共享打印机,测试打印一页确认恢复正常
此步骤会清掉所有待打印队列,完成后需要重新发送打印任务。整个清除→重启流程如下。
方法三 修复 0x0000011b 注册表配置
2021 年后 Windows 安全补丁对 MS-RPRN 加密策略做了收紧,导致旧共享打印机出现错误码 0x0000011b;在注册表中添加一条 DWORD 值即可绕过此限制,Windows 10/11 均适用。
操作步骤
- 按
Win+R,输入regedit,回车,打开注册表编辑器 - 在左侧依次展开
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print - 在右侧空白处右键→新建→DWORD(32 位)值,命名为 RpcAuthnLevelPrivacyEnabled
- 双击该值,将数值数据改为 0,点确定
- 重启电脑,再次连接共享打印机验证
此修改仅针对局域网内可信设备的打印共享场景,适用于更新 Windows 补丁后突然出现 0x0000011b 的情况。
方法四 核对共享端设置与防火墙
连接共享打印机前,先确认安装打印机的那台电脑(共享端)已正确开启共享并放行防火墙;用 \\IP地址\打印机共享名 格式直连可绕过 NetBIOS 名称解析问题,更可靠。
操作步骤
- 在共享端打开「控制面板→设备和打印机」,右键打印机→打印机属性→「共享」选项卡,确认已勾选「共享这台打印机」,记下共享名称(如 Canon_G3800)
- 确认共享端 Print Spooler 服务正在运行(见方法一)
- 打开「控制面板→Windows Defender 防火墙→允许应用通过防火墙」,确认「文件和打印机共享」在专用网络与公用网络列均已勾选
- 在共享端命令提示符输入
ipconfig,记录 IPv4 地址(如 192.168.1.5) - 客户端按
Win+R,输入\\192.168.1.5\Canon_G3800(替换为实际 IP 和共享名),回车连接
以下对比能帮你快速排查共享端最容易漏掉的配置项。
方法五 开启网络发现与 SMB 协议
若两台电脑网段不同、来宾账户被禁用,或客户端与共享端 SMB 版本不匹配,共享打印机会对客户端"隐身",需要分别调整网络发现策略和 SMB 支持。
操作步骤
- 在共享端打开「控制面板→网络和共享中心→更改高级共享设置」,展开「所有网络」,开启「网络发现」与「文件和打印机共享」,保存修改
- 若客户端提示找不到网络路径,按
Win+R输入secpol.msc,进入「安全设置→本地策略→安全选项」,将「网络访问:本地账户的共享和安全模型」改为「经典」 - 若共享端为 Windows 10/11、客户端为 Windows 7,需要在共享端以管理员身份打开 PowerShell,运行
Enable-WindowsOptionalFeature -Online -FeatureName smb1protocol,重启后重新连接 - 重新在客户端添加网络打印机,或直接用
\\共享端IP\共享名格式连接
跨网段场景(如共享端 192.168.0.x、客户端 192.168.1.x)还需路由器或网络管理员配置 VLAN 互通,仅靠系统设置无法解决。
用「软领打印机驱动修复大师」更省事
手动进注册表或 services.msc 对普通用户有一定门槛。「软领打印机驱动修复大师」的智能打印修复功能可自动扫描打印机设置、Print Spooler 状态、打印队列状态、共享配置及 SMB 协议异常,将注册表错误(如 RpcAuthnLevelPrivacyEnabled 缺失)和共享错误码 0x00000bc4 等问题逐一列出,点「一键修复」批量处理,不用手动进 regedit 或命令行。

打印机共享功能提供「共享我的打印机」与「连接共享打印机」两种方式,并内置共享环境检测,省去逐项手动核对的步骤。

软领是知名国产软件品牌,20 年技术沉淀,服务千万用户;软件从官网 wyouhua.com 直接下载,安装无捆绑勾选项。如今到处都是 AI 客服,想找到一个真人很难——软领旗下所有产品的界面上都有客服按钮,点一下就能联系到真人客服帮你解决打印机问题,复杂的共享连接问题还有专业工程师远程协助。

常见问题
Windows无法连接到打印机服务器错误码0x0000011b怎么解决?
这是 Windows 安全补丁收紧 MS-RPRN 加密策略后的问题。在注册表 H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print 下新建 DWORD 值 RpcAuthnLevelPrivacyEnabled 并设为 0,重启后重新连接共享打印机即可(见方法三)。
本地打印后台处理程序服务没有运行怎么修复?
按 Win+R 输入 services.msc,找到 Print Spooler,右键→启动,并将启动类型改为「自动」。若服务启动后立刻停止,先停服务、删除 C:\Windows\System32\spool\PRINTERS 目录内所有文件,再重启服务(见方法二)。
局域网共享打印机连不上有哪些原因?
常见原因有:Print Spooler 服务停止、PRINTERS 目录有卡件、注册表缺少 RpcAuthnLevelPrivacyEnabled 配置、共享端打印机未开启共享、防火墙阻断文件和打印机共享端口、网络发现未开启或 SMB 版本不匹配。按方法一到五逐步排查基本能定位。
用 \\IP\打印机共享名 连接提示找不到网络路径怎么办?
先确认 IP 和共享名正确(共享端运行 ipconfig 查 IPv4,打印机属性→共享选项卡查共享名),再检查共享端防火墙是否放行「文件和打印机共享」。若仍失败,在两台电脑都开启「网络发现」(见方法五)。
错误码0x00000bc4是什么意思?
表示找不到打印机,通常是共享端 Spooler 停止、打印机共享未开启或客户端缺少驱动所致。「软领打印机驱动修复大师」的智能打印修复功能可自动扫描 0x00000bc4 异常并修复。
推荐阅读
相关推荐

提示